ENESTnd DASISION

imatinib nilotinib difference imatinib dasatinib difference

CCyR at 12 month 65% 80% 15 73% 85% 12

CCyR at 24 month 77% 87% 10 82% 85% 3

PFS at 24 month 95.2% 98.0% 3 92.1% 93.7% 2

OS at 24 month 96.3 97.4% 1 95.2% 95.3% 0

Blue indicates a statistically significant differenceRed indicates a non significant difference

Early efficacy of nilotinib and dasatinib in comparison to imatinib

Saglio et al, NEJM 2010Kantarjian et al, NEJM 2010Kantarjian et al, Lancet Onc 2011Kantarjian et al, Blood 2012

TKIs in CML

(European license)

NICE

• TA251: first line treatment– 25 April 2012– Imatinib & nilotinib approved– Subject to Patient Access Scheme (PAS)– Dasatinib not approved (no PAS offered)

• TA 241: second line– 13 January 2012– Same as above

NICE

• Dasatinib– “People currently receiving dasatinib that is not

recommended according to 1.3 should be able to continue treatment until they and their clinician consider it appropriate to stop”

– Minimum free supply in SPIRIT 2 to 2018

– NICE rapid review currently in process

NICE• Bosutinib

– considered June 2013

– FAD approx Oct 2013

• Ponatinib

– no time frame as yet

So where are we now?

• Most CML patients are fine– There are more and more…

• Not much difference between TKIs?– Apart from cost and perhaps side effects– Use wisely/selectively– Imatinib off patent 2016

• We really need to figure out how to reduce and/or stop treatment for a lot more patients
